    Type Dimension﹙mm﹚
      A B C Dmin Emin F L
    EE19/8/5 19.3±0.3 8.15±0.1 4.78±0.1 5.5 13.9 4.78±0.1 2.4
    EE25/10/7 25.4±0.4 9.53±0.15 6.35±0.1 6.2 18.8 6.35±0.1 3.2
    EE30/15/7 30.05±0.45 15.0±0.2 7.06±0.1 9.7 19.5 6.96±0.1 5.1
    EE35/14/9 34.5±0.5 14.1±0.2 9.35±0.15 9.6 25.3 9.3±0.15 4.4
    EE41/17/13 40.9±0.6 16.5±0.25 12.5±0.2 10.4 28.3 12.5±0.2 6
    EE43/21/11 42.85±0.65 21.1±0.3 10.8±0.25 15 30.4 11.9±0.2 5.9
    EE43/21/15 42.85±0.65 21.1±0.3 15.4±0.25 15 30.4 11.9±0.2 5.9
    EE43/21/20 42.85±0.65 21.1±0.3 20.0±0.3 15 30.4 11.9±0.2 5.9
    EE55/28/21 54.9±0.8 27.6±0.4 20.6±0.4 18.5 37.5 16.8±0.25 8.4
    EE55/28/25 54.9±0.8 27.6±0.4 24.6±0.4 18.5 37.5 16.8±0.25 8.4
    EE65/33/27 65.1±1.0 32.5±0.5 27.0±0.4 22.2 44.2 19.7±0.3 10
    EE72/28/19 72.4±1.1 27.9±0.4 19.0±0.1 17.8 52.6 19.1±0.3 9.6
    EE80/38/20 80.0±1.2 38.1±0.6 19.85±0.25 28.1 59.3 19.8±0.3 9.9
    EE80/45/20 80.0±1.2 45.1±0.7 19.85±0.25 34.7 59.3 19.8±0.3 9.9
    EE130/38/40 130.3±2.0 32.5±0.5 54.0±0.8 22 108.4 20.0±0.3 10
    EE160/38/40 160.0±2.5 39.6±0.6 39.6±0.6 28.1 138.2 19.8±0.3 9.9

    Advantages:

    1. Good high-frequency characteristics: It can maintain low loss in a high-frequency environment, making it suitable for high-frequency circuits such as switching power supplies.

    2. High permeability: It has a high permeability, which can effectively gather and guide the magnetic field, improving the efficiency of electromagnetic conversion.

    3. Low loss: It has low loss under an alternating magnetic field, which can reduce energy consumption and improve the efficiency of equipment.

    4. Good temperature stability: Its performance remains stable at different temperatures, and it is not prone to changes in magnetic properties.

    5. High reliability: It has good mechanical strength and corrosion resistance, enabling long-term stable operation.

    6. Good machinability: It is easy to machine into various shapes and sizes, facilitating manufacturing and application.

    Application Fields:

    1. Power field: Used in uninterruptible power supplies, photovoltaic inverters, energy storage systems, etc., as the core of inductors or transformers, playing roles in filtering, energy storage, step-up and step-down, etc.

    2. Communication field: In communication equipment such as program-controlled exchanges and routers, it is used for signal transmission and filtering to ensure the stability and reliability of communication.

    3. Industrial control field: In industrial automation control systems, it is used for motor control, sensor signal processing, etc., to achieve precise control of equipment.

    4. New energy vehicle field: As an inductor element in new energy vehicles, it is used in power management systems, motor drive systems, etc., to improve the energy utilization efficiency and performance of vehicles.

    5. Medical equipment field: In some medical equipment such as ECG machines and nuclear magnetic resonance instruments, it is used for signal processing and detection to ensure the accuracy and safety of the equipment.
